Dive into The Trout Show, the ultimate podcast for music lovers hosted by Rick Troutman, aka The Trout—a Texas-born songwriter, musician, producer, and lifelong connector from the Dallas-Fort Worth scene. With roots in classic rock and soul, Rick brings you intimate interviews with legends and rising stars like Tesla's Frank Hannon, blues prodigy Rhys Stygal, and soul icon Merry Clayton. Reeling in stories from the heart of the industry, from SRV-inspired riffs to sync soundtrack triumphs, this show hooks boomer fans with nostalgic vibes and fresh sonic tales. Today on the show, we welcome one of the UK's most exciting and hard-working independent acts in the blues-rock scene. Hailing from Essex, England, When Rivers Meet is the powerhouse husband-and-wife duo of Grace and Aaron Bond. Since forming in 2016, they've carved their own path without major label support — touring in a camper van, captivating audiences with raw, gritty blues, soaring vocals, and thunderous guitar riffs that blend rock, Americana, and folk.
